What is your experience with designing and delivering training programs?

Sample answer to the question

I have some experience with designing and delivering training programs. In my previous role as a change management assistant, I assisted in the design and delivery of training programs for employees undergoing organizational changes. This involved creating training materials, coordinating training sessions, and conducting evaluations to measure the effectiveness of the training. I have also worked with subject matter experts to gather information and develop training content. Overall, I have a good understanding of the principles and methodologies of training program design and delivery.

An exceptional answer

Throughout my career, I have successfully designed and delivered training programs that have played a significant role in facilitating successful organizational change. For instance, in my previous role as a Change Management Consultant at XYZ Company, I led the design and delivery of a comprehensive training program for a major ERP implementation project. I collaborated with project teams and subject matter experts to gather information and develop training content that aligned with the project objectives. Leveraging my expertise in instructional design, I created engaging and interactive training materials, including e-learning modules, job aids, and instructor-led workshops. To ensure maximum effectiveness, I conducted pilot sessions and solicited feedback from participants, which allowed me to make necessary adjustments. As a result, the training program received positive reviews from employees, with a significant increase in adoption and usage of the new system. My ability to effectively communicate and collaborate with stakeholders, coupled with my strong analytical and decision-making abilities, allowed me to identify potential resistance points and adjust the training approach accordingly. This experience has further honed my expertise in change management principles and methodologies, making me well-equipped to design and deliver training programs that drive successful organizational change.

Why this is an exceptional answer:

The exceptional answer provides specific and detailed examples of the candidate's experience with designing and delivering training programs, highlighting specific accomplishments and the impact of their work. It also emphasizes their ability to collaborate with stakeholders, communicate effectively, and utilize analytical and decision-making abilities. This answer goes above and beyond in demonstrating the candidate's understanding and expertise in change management principles and methodologies.

How to prepare for this question

  • Familiarize yourself with change management principles, methodologies, and tools. Understand how training programs fit into the overall change management process.
  • Highlight your experience in designing and delivering training programs, specifically in the context of organizational change.
  • Provide specific examples of training programs you have developed and delivered, including the impact they had on driving adoption and usage of new processes or systems.
  • Demonstrate your collaboration and communication skills by discussing how you have worked with cross-functional teams and key stakeholders to gather input and design effective training programs.
  • Highlight your analytical and decision-making abilities by discussing how you have identified potential risks and resistance points and developed mitigation plans.
